Abstract

The present application discloses humanized 9E4 antibodies. The antibodies bind to human alpha synuclein and can be used for immunotherapy of Lewy body disease.

Claims (16)

1. An antibody that binds alpha synuclein, comprising a mature heavy chain variable region having the amino acid sequence of SEQ ID NO: 11 and a mature light chain variable region having the amino acid sequence of SEQ ID NO:4 except provided that position L36 (Kabat numbering) can be occupied by Y or F, position L83 (Kabat numbering) can be occupied by F or L, position H73 (Kabat numbering) can be occupied by N or D and position H93 (Kabat numbering) can be occupied by A or S.

2. The antibody of claim 1 , wherein the mature heavy chain variable region has the amino acid sequence designated SEQ ID NO:10.

3. The antibody of claim 1 , wherein the mature light chain variable region has the amino acid sequence designated SEQ ID NO:5.

4. The antibody of claim 1 , wherein position H73 (Kabat numbering) is occupied by D and position H93 (Kabat numbering) is occupied by A.

5. The antibody of claim 1 , wherein the mature variable light chain has the amino acid sequence of SEQ ID NO:3, 4 or 5 and the mature variable heavy chain has the amino acid sequence of SEQ ID NO:8, 9 or 10.

6. The antibody of claim 5 , comprising a heavy chain constant region having the amino acid sequence of SEQ ID NO:32.

7. The antibody of claim 5 , comprising a light chain constant region having the amino acid sequence of SEQ ID NO:13.

8. An antibody that binds alpha synuclein, comprising a humanized heavy chain comprising the three Kabat CDRs of SEQ ID NO:11 and a humanized light chain comprising the three CDRs of SEQ ID NO:4 provided that position L36 (Kabat numbering) is occupied by F and/or position L83 (Kabat numbering) is occupied by L and/or position H73 (Kabat numbering) is occupied by D, and/or position H93 (Kabat numbering) is occupied by S.

9. The antibody of claim 8 , comprising a mature heavy chain variable region having the amino acid sequence designated SEQ ID NO:10 and a mature light chain variable region having the amino acid sequence designated SEQ ID NO:5.

10. The antibody of claim 8 , wherein position L36 (Kabat numbering) is occupied by F and position L83 (Kabat numbering) is occupied by L.

11. The antibody of claim 8 , provided that position L36 (Kabat numbering) is occupied by F.

12. The antibody of claim 8 , provided that position L83 (Kabat numbering) is occupied by L.

13. The antibody of claim 8 , provided that position H73 (Kabat numbering) is occupied by D.

14. The antibody of claim 1 or 8 , comprising a heavy chain constant region of human IgG1 isotype.

15. A pharmaceutical composition comprising an antibody as defined by claim 1 or 8 .

16. The antibody of claim 1 or 8 that is a Fab fragment.
